Why Live in Valley Park Forest
Valley Park Forest, a suburban neighborhood in Fort Wayne, is characterized by tree-lined streets and manicured lots. Located just over 5 miles from downtown Fort Wayne, it offers convenient access to shopping, libraries, and elementary schools within walking distance. The neighborhood features a mix of sprawling ranch-style, Colonial Revival-inspired two-story homes, and some Tudor Revival and Cape Cod styles, mostly built between 1970 and 1990. Residents enjoy well-kept sidewalks and proximity to large community parks, making it an active area. Kreager Park, less than 2 miles away, offers fitness equipment, sports fields, a playground, and access to the 26-mile Rivergreenway trail. Jehl Park, less than a mile away, includes a tennis court, basketball court, and playground. Georgetown Square, a large shopping center within the neighborhood, houses retailers like Kroger and Dollar General, small businesses, and popular restaurants such as Ziffles Rib Bar and Jeff's Coney. The area is also close to Northwood Plaza and Statewood Plaza, providing additional shopping options. Fort Wayne hosts the annual Three Rivers Festival, Greek and Latin festivals, and is home to minor-league sports teams, with venues like Parkview Field and the Allen County War Memorial Coliseum nearby. Indiana State Route 930 and U.S. Interstate Highway 469 provide easy access to major highways, and Fort Wayne International Airport is just over 14 miles away. Public transit is available with bus stops in Georgetown Square.
